Rain/Light Recognition Sensor -G397-, REMOVING AND INSTALLING: Notes
Risk of unintended engine start
The ignition must be turned off and the ignition key must remain outside of the vehicle when working on vehicles with a high voltage system.
Depending on time period of production (from MY 2012 as a running change) and vehicle version, the Humidity Sensor -G355- no longer operates as an individual part in the DTC memory. For these vehicles, if there is a difference on the Humidity Sensor -G355-, the Rain/Light Recognition Sensor -G397- is displayed as the faulty location using the Vehicle Diagnostic Tester in the "Guided Fault Finding " function.
Starting from MY 2010, there is a running change for the version of the Humidity Sensor -G355- (with or without Rain/Light Recognition Sensor -G397-). Removing and installing is different for both versions. Depending on the date of manufacture and the vehicle version, version "1" (discontinued as a running change through MY 2009) or version "2" (running change from MY 2010) can be installed.
